Quote:
Originally Posted by 370ZQ View Post
luckily i saw your post cos i was just on their website.
do you have any advice to prevent the scratch?
take it to somewhere that cares about ur rims. Get a shop manager to walk around the car first and check the rims before they touched it. Ask them to get the best guy on the job. Bring a camera and take lots of pictures of the wheels they gonna be working on right in front of them so this way they know you have pictures just in case. When they are done make sure u check the rims very good. Clean all the dirt off and check inside and outside. Check around the wheel weight balance also. If you see any marks tell the manager right away! Don't leave the shop! If they mess up ur rims rise hell and tell them you want a NEW SET!!!
